I've always been a big Boba Fett fan ever since I was a kid and saw him onscreen. I didn't care that he only had three lines (four if his scream in ROTJ is included) that he only stood around most of the time, and that he got taken out by a blind man.
Now, here come the prequels and we get daddy Fett (Jango) and we see why a FETT can be such a badass. Now it is easier to see what Boba is capable of. Jango took out a Jedi and held his own with Kenobi. It took one of the top two Jedi in the Order to finally take out Jango. Jango = badass!
And, while Grievous didn't kill any Jedi, he did manage to take out a few Clonetroopers on Utapau while driving his wheelbike, and he held his own against Kenobi as well which is far far more than Boba ever did in any of the movies.
Boba will always hold that sense of coolness for me that I've had since childhood, but Grievous gets that badass stamp due to what is shown in the movie.
Neither would get the title "wuzz" though.
